Part Of Prairie Path To Close For Construction Through May In Wheaton
The construction on Prairie Path will also impact parking on part of Carlton Avenue.

WHEATON, IL — Part of Prairie Path will be closed through May to accommodate construction, according to an update from the City of Wheaton.
The construction, which is expected to start April 7, will close Prairie Path from Liberty Drive to Roosevelt Road. During this time, parking will not be permitted on the western side of Carlton Avenue, but drivers may park in the nearby lot at Carlton and Liberty.
Bicyclists who normally take Prairie Path will be able to access detours via Delles Road or West Street.
